Output e17bcb4afd52941b0ce83de7e2ed0da96d9a4e443ee17625e0e7ece95db2c657:2

value
1223000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93638a76ccef76efe7d88bab40ce2378f8292388 OP_EQUAL
address
3F8LVxsShh5WuAavTymwtyyFG1KvAJyaNe
transaction
e17bcb4afd52941b0ce83de7e2ed0da96d9a4e443ee17625e0e7ece95db2c657
confirmations
337710
spent
true